According to Alec White of the team, the Buffalo Bills have re-signed quarterback Shane Buechele (neck) to a one-year deal. The Texas native spent the entirety of the 2024 season on injured reserve with a neck injury he sustained in the preseason and was previously a member of the Bills' practice squad in 2023. Buechele went undrafted out of SMU in 2021 and was signed by Kansas City, though he never recorded a snap. He'd then get a year off in 2022 before finding his way to Buffalo the following season. The 27-year-old's collegiate profile is nothing of note, brandishing one season with more than 3,100 passing yards and 23 touchdowns. However, his familiarity with Buffalo's system makes him a valuable emergency option should anything happen to the players ahead of him. He'll now attempt to work his way to their 53-man roster in 2025.

New York Jets quarterback Jordan Travis (ankle) has experienced some setbacks and is not expected to be activated from the non-football injury list before the end of the 2024 NFL season, interim head coach Jeff Ulbrich said Wednesday. Travis suffered the injury while competing at Florida State University last season, and he was placed on the NFI list near the end of training camp. Ulbrich noted that he checks in with Travis daily, and even though his recovery isn't going as expected, the Jets' coach loves the young quarterback's work ethic and believes he can still be an impact player. Fantasy managers will likely have to wait until next year before getting a glimpse of Travis in a Jets uniform. In the meantime, New York's quarterback room will continue to feature veterans Aaron Rodgers and Tyrod Taylor.
